M.Sc-M.Sc Bio Chemistry 2nd Sem BCH - 270 : Bioenergetics and Metabolism(University of Pune, Pune-2013)

Friday, 28 November 2014 01:53Nitha

                             M.Sc. (Semester - II)

                             BIOCHEMISTRY


SEAT No. :

[Total No. of Pages : 2


BCH - 270 : Bioenergetics and Metabolism

(2008 & 2010 Pattern)

Time : 3 Hours]                                                                                               [Max. Marks : 80

Instructions to the candidates :

1) All questions are compulsory.

2) Figures to the right side indicate full marks.

3) Answers to the two sections should be written in separate answer books.

SECTION - I

Q1) Answer any five of the following :                                                                   [15]

 

“Although O2 is not involved in any step of TCA cycle yet the cycle is

aerobic”. Explain.

Why animals cannot effect the net conversion of lipid to carbohydrates

while plant or microorganism can? Illustrate your answer with enzyme- catalysed reactions involved in the net conversion of lipid to carbohydrate.

Write note on high energy compounds.

Differentiate between C3 and C4 pathways.

Tabulate the glycogen storage diseases with details of defective enzymes

and clinical features.

What is Pasteur effect?


Q2) Answer any three of the following :                                                                [15]

 

Outline the steps involved in pentose phosphate pathway.

Explain all the reactions involved in the conversion of lactic to glucose. Describe non-cyclic photophosphorylation and its significance.

Discuss chemiosmotic hypothesis of Peter mitchell in the formation of

ATP.

P.T.O.

Q3) Answer any two of the following :                                                                  [10]

 

Explain the role of hormones in the regulation of glycogenesis and

glycogenolysis.

Discuss the amphibolic role of TCA cycle.

Describe the reactions involved in the formation of Ascorbic acid from

glucose.

SECTION - II


Q4) Answer any five of the following :                                                                   [15]


Write note on phenylketonuria and Alkaptonuria.

Give the significance of decarboxylation of amino acids with suitable

examples.

What is the role of ribonucleotide reductase in our body?

What are ketone bodies? How are they formed?

List out the steps involved in the biosynthesis of polyamines.

How isb-alanine formed during pyrimidine catabolism?


Q5) Answer any three of the following :                                                                 [15]


Outline the cycle of reactions that converts Ammonia to Urea. Explainb-oxidation of palmitic acid with energetics. Discuss the biosynthesis of phenylalanine.

Elaborate on the regulation of biosynthesis of purine and pyrimidine

nucleotides.


Q6) Answer any two of the following :                                                                   [10]

a)       How are triglycerides prepared in our body.

b)       Explain the role of CDP in phospholipid biosynthesis.

c)       Describe the steps involved in formation of Uric acid.
